Westendorf, Austria

Westendorf is by far the best boarding spot in the Ski Welt area. Unlike the other resorts which make up the ski welt Westendorf stands alone and is only linked to the other resorts by road. If you’re anything but a beginner don’t let this put you off, as Westendorf is home to the only park of note in the area, some steep long off piste tree runs and some of the areas steepest and highest terrain. The backside of the mountain now connects up to the Kitzbuhel valley by an eight person bubble and a short bus ride (you will need a separate pass to ride in Kitzbuhel). Riding here you’ll be in the company of other boarders who are trying to escape the beginner friendly cruising pistes of the main ski welt area.

Resort Statistics

Lifts

Total Lifts: 13
Gondolas: 3
Chair lifts: 7
Drag lifts: 3
Board Leashes required: No

Mountain

Total ride area: 50km

Top lift: 1892m
Vertical drop: 1103m
First lift: 789m

Piste suitability

Green runs: 40%
Red runs: 60%
